Azerbaijan's insurance market grows by 14%

In January-November of this year, 875.132 million manats ($514.78 million) in insurance premiums were collected through 20 insurance companies in Azerbaijan, 14% more year-on-year, Report informs, citing the Central Bank of Azerbaijan
During the reporting period, the of payments made by insurance companies amounted to 400.953 million manats ($235.85 million), 6.7% less than a year ago.
During the first eleven months of the year, 45.8 manats ($26.94) were paid for every 100 manats ($58.82) collected in the insurance market. In the same period last year, this figure was 56 manats ($32.94).
